Softonic review

Mining and tower defense hybrid

Wall World is a premium action game for PC made by developer Alawar Premium. It is a mining simulator that incorporates tower defense mechanics and roguelike elements in its gameplay. In it, players will explore and attempt to discover the secrets of a vast walled world.

Similar to Dome Romantik or Tower Tactics: Liberation, Wall World seamlessly combines open-world exploration, mining, and tower defense for an engaging and challenging gameplay experience. Players will need to balance gathering resources and being wary of oncoming enemies to not wander too far from their bases and be left defenseless to attacks.

A mysterious walled world

The game takes place in the titular Wall World, a place closed off to the outside. This enigmatic realm houses all manner of secrets and rich resources within its confines. You play as a budding adventurer, together with your trusty robospider, who will explore this land and discover everything it has in store for anyone brave enough to venture into its depths.

Wall World boasts a high level of verticality and you'll spend most of your time upright and climbing. Set up camp at any point and dig a hole through the wall to start exploring and gather materials for upgrades. The game features multiple unique biomes to discover but be wary of enemy creatures attacking as you'll need to board your robospider to defend against them.

Use upgrades to put up turrets to help fend off attacks, repair stations to fix damage to your hull, and resource harvesters to gather material faster. Suffice it to say, this game is quite challenging and can be overwhelming to new players. This is further compounded by the fact that there's a high level of grinding involved to progress, which some will not like.

Dig, mine, defend

Overall, Wall World is a nice twist that builds upon the gameplay loop from Dome Romantik. It boasts a large world to explore, various upgrades to help on your journey, and offers players a nice challenge to those who want it. Some will find it a bit too hard at times, but there's plenty of fun to be had with it all the same.
